Product Description:

The QS1L03AA07E01P00 servo amplifier is produced by Sanyo Denki as part of the Q SANMOTION Servo Amplifiers series. It drives matched servomotors in industrial automation equipment, receiving command signals from a motion controller and converting them into phased current that follows reference speed, torque, or position loops. The unit supports packaging stations, robotic axes, and surface-mount lines where accurate dynamic response and compact installation are required, consolidating power conversion, protection, and regenerative features inside a single enclosure.

The power stage delivers up to 30 A, so moderate-to-high-inertia loads can be accelerated without saturation. A three-phase input rated for 200 V supplies the internal bus, while the synthesized output bandwidth reaches 600 Hz to track high-frequency command changes. The pulse-direction port accepts streams up to 5 Mpps, letting indexers execute very short moves without losing resolution. Velocity regulation spans a ratio of 1:5000, giving fine control from a slow jog to full rated speed. Built-in speed, torque, and position control functions are complemented by a cooling fan that removes switching heat. An integral dynamic brake clamps motion during emergency stops, and regeneration circuitry directs excess energy to an onboard resistor instead of requiring external dump hardware.

The internal resistor presents a load of 50 Ω to limit DC-bus voltage rise when braking heavy axes. Drive waveforms are produced by an IGBT PWM sinusoidal drive system, which lowers torque ripple and acoustic noise. Mechanical integration is aided by compact dimensions of 168 × 160 × 70 mm, and the amplifier weighs 1.3 kg. A built-in tray-type power supply eliminates the need for separate converters. The enclosure accommodates the regeneration circuitry, cooling fan, and dynamic brake without requiring additional external modules.
